Website Tracking for B2B businesses: Needs and Types of Data Required

It’s impossible to operate a business without knowing the action and response of the customers. You cannot implement marketing or sales strategies without knowing what customers expect from you and your company. So, it’s always recommended to use one of the best website click trackers.

 

The website tracking defines the activities as well as the characteristics of the visitors on the website. With this, the owner gets insights into the visitor’s needs, activities and requirements. Also, it provides information on how visitors came to the website and their geographical profile.

 

The website click trackers are very vast. They are used differently in different companies because the objectives aren’t the same.

 

In this blog, we will discuss the needs of website tracking for B2B businesses. Also, we list the types of data they require for proper functioning.

 

Website tracking needs of B2B businesses 

Not only statistical data, but B2B businesses need data about individual visitors, leads, and customers. They primarily need the details to improve and enhance their sales and marketing process. The B2B business owners work on each qualified lead individually. For them, every lead coming from any source has a higher ticket value and can be converted easily if worked properly. The website tracking needs of B2B businesses are completely different from B2C businesses.

 

Types of data need to tracked for B2B businesses 

 

Activity tracking 

As the name suggests, activity tracking keeps an eye on the activities performed by the visitors. It includes page visits, link clicks, button clicks, custom events, visit duration, etc. The number of these elements depends on the website click tracker used.

 

Some examples of activity tracking are to know the visit of the leads on particular pages, webinars seen by them, or the other sets of actions performed by them on the website. It helps to market qualified leads and nurture them.

 

Campaign tracking 

If a campaign is launched online, the website tracking helps in knowing the number of leads coming through it. Entry of the visitors through such campaigns, keywords, or Google search defines their interests. It shows what people are searching online and what their intentions are.

 

With the help of the campaigns, the sales and marketing teams in the B2B companies approach the leads related to that feature. They start working on the same keywords and try improving the ranking as much as possible.

 

Lead acquisition and tracking 

Some website click trackers have lead acquisition and tracking options. With this, B2B businesses can detect and capture leads from different acquisition channels. For example, a visitor filling out a form on the website gives details and an opportunity to the sales team to start the selling process.

 

Other than the form on the website, the other channels for lead acquisition are live chat, email campaigns, etc.  The process is a bit tricky but very effective.

 

As a B2B business owner, thing you should consider when choosing a website click tracker 

Keeping aside everything, you should make sure that the website click tracker provides data in real-time. Most service providers provide updates only a few times a day. If the tracking is delayed, you can only take a reactive approach. Real-time data will help you in retargeting, pushing promotional offers in real-time, and fast-tracking qualified leads.
